Abstract
The present invention discloses in a kind of mobile device identity information acquisition parts as the apparatus and method of peripheral hardware, described mobile device includes processor and acquisition component, described acquisition component is electrically connected with processor by internal usb bus, also include: peripheral hardware USB port, for connecting the computer USB port of outside, for the computer USB cable outside mobile device access;Peripheral hardware USB testing circuit, for detecting the access external USB signal of external USB mouth, and produces enable signal;Bus switch, for according to enabling signal, exporting, by the collection data of acquisition component, the computer USB cable that peripheral hardware USB port is connect.In the mobile device of the present invention, identity information acquisition parts are as the device of peripheral hardware, realize the flexible Application of acquisition component in mobile device, functional module can be directly invoked, it is to avoid the problem causing user's overlapping investment because multiple functional parts concentrate on one by this device.

Background technology
The most relatively common general USB external device, by processor, upstream USB interface, downstream USB interface, state
Recognition unit, the management composition such as control chip and general line system chip, its technological means is mainly upstream USB excuse and connects main
Machine, downstream USB makes an excuse and is used for connecting USB peripheral, and the USB interface access of state recognition unit detecting downstream or the equipment removed also will
Its state sends processor, and processor controls the connecting and disconnecting of upstream and downstream USB interface, and upstream USB is connect by general line system chip
The usb bus of mouth transfers internal bus to.
Use this type of technology, system or equipment can be made by outside USB to independent equipment (such as photographic head, card reader etc.)
Put device to be controlled, extension existed system and the function of equipment.But this kind equipment is also only limitted to the extension of USB interface, can only
Increase single external device, it is impossible in existing integrated equipment, use one of them or several functional module equipment, example
Mobile phone such as certain model is used for fingerprint collecting and identification with fingerprint capturer, but when desk computer is connected to mobile phone,
Its fingerprint capturer cannot be used.

Embodiment
Referring to Fig. 1, in a kind of mobile device of the embodiment of the present invention, identity information acquisition parts are as the device of peripheral hardware, bag
Include described mobile device to include for receiving the processor 11 processing collection data and in order to gather the identity of personnel to be detected
The acquisition component 16 of information, described acquisition component 16 is electrically connected with processor 11 by internal usb bus, wherein processor 11
For FPGA or ARM flush bonding processor, assembly of the invention also includes the following:
Peripheral hardware USB port 13, for connecting the computer USB port 21 of outside, for the computer USB outside mobile device access
Cable;
Peripheral hardware USB testing circuit 12, for detecting the access external USB signal of external USB mouth 13, and produces enable letter
Number;
Bus switch 14, for according to enabling signal, exporting peripheral hardware USB port 13 by the collection data of acquisition component 16
The computer usb bus connect, described internal usb bus is processor 11 and the cable of bus switch 14.
As another embodiment, described acquisition component 16 includes light compensating lamp 161, photographic head 162, card reader 163, refers to
At least one in stricture of vagina instrument 164, network interface 165, in the embodiments illustrated in the figures, preferential 5 selected in above-mentioned each parts are same
Time use.
As another embodiment, above-mentioned acquisition component 16 is connected to a usb hub 15 by USB cable the most respectively
Multiple USB port inputs, the cable between bus switch 14 and usb hub 15 is usb hub bus, described USB
Hub 15 is by separating multiple USB port in usb hub bus, it is achieved being uniformly accessed into of multiple collecting devices.Shown in Fig. 1
Embodiment, each acquisition component 16 gathered total data outfan by described usb hub 15, this total data outfan then with
Bus switch 14 connects, thus realizes selectivity and connect internal usb bus and computer usb bus.
Referring to Fig. 2 and Fig. 3, for the schematic diagram of peripheral hardware USB testing circuit and the bus switch of apparatus of the present invention,
What bus switch 14 was connected with peripheral hardware USB testing circuit 12 is enables holding wire, be used for obtaining enable signal and
Carry out bus switch action.
Described peripheral hardware testing circuit 12, has specifically included in the present embodiment: the first divider resistance R1, the second dividing potential drop electricity
Resistance R2, the insulated gate bipolar transistor Q1 and the 3rd resistance R3 of band damper diode, described first divider resistance R1 and second
After divider resistance R2 series connection, at one end it is electrically connected with the voltage port of external USB mouth, other end ground connection;Described insulated gate is double
Bipolar transistor Q1 gate pole is electrically connected at the first divider resistance R1 and the common port of the second divider resistance R2, and its emitter stage connects
Ground, is electrically connected with power supply, and the voltage signal of colelctor electrode is as enabling letter after its collector series connection the 3rd divider resistance R3
Number.
Peripheral hardware USB port 13 uses USB transport protocol, is used for connecting computer USB cable.When connecting USB interface of computer
When the USB cable of 21 accesses the peripheral hardware USB port 13 of mobile device, peripheral hardware USB testing circuit 12 triggers, to bus switch 14
Send enable signal.
Bus switch 14 in the present embodiment include controller 141 and the alternative gated by controller 141 leads to
Road 142, described controller 141 receives enable signal then alternative path 142 and is switched to alternate path connection by the first path, always
Positivity input and negativity input that line switch has connect acquisition component or usb hub total data delivery end, bus
The first positivity outfan, the first positivity outfan that switch has connect internal usb bus, bus switch as the first path
The second positivity outfan that utensil has, the second negativity outfan as alternate path connect peripheral hardware USB port positivity data terminal and
Negativity data terminal, now, all acquisition component 16 under usb hub 15 in mobile device all by peripheral hardware USB port with outer
Portion's computer is electrically connected with.
